There are three primary types of rowing machines which include air rowers and water rowers, and magnetic rowers. Air rowers utilize a fan to create resistance, water rowers employ paddles set in a pool water to generate resistance, magnetic rowers utilize magnets to create resistance. Each kind of rowing machine has its advantages and drawbacks. Air rowers are most affordable, however they're also the most likely to be noisy and create a lot of vibration. Water rowers are the quietest alternative, however they're one of the more costly. Magnetic rowers are somewhere in the middle in terms of cost, but they have a effortless rowing movements that are easy on your joints.

Workouts with the rowing machine

The rowing machine can be a an amazing workout for all body. There are various kinds of rowing machines, each with their own advantages and disadvantages. The primary kind of rower is an air-rowed machine. Air rowers rely on the force provided by a fan to give you the workout you need. They are generally more affordable than other types of rowers. They can also be put away when not using them. However, they can be noisy and don't offer the same level of resistance as of the other kinds of rowers. The second kind of machine for rowing is also known as the water rower. Water rowers use resistance created by water to give you the workout you need. They are often more expensive than air rowers however offer the more realistic experience of rowing. However, they can be heavy and require more space for storage. The third type of rower is the magnetic one. Magnetic rowers use magnets to create resistance instead of water or air. They tend to be more expensive than other kinds of rowers, however they offer more comfort when rowing. However, they might not offer the same amount of resistance as some of the other kinds of rowers.
